Kohler Co. Manager Information Technology, PMO in Kohler, Wisconsin

Manager Information Technology, PMO

This role is responsible for managing a team of project management professionals to plan and manage the execution of an IT portfolio made up of projects (waterfall) and product teams (agile). Key success factors for the role include building a strong, diverse team, developing talent, knowledge and practical application of project methodologies, establishes clear outcomes for success and positively impacts the engagement of the team and stakeholders.

Specific Responsibilities

  • Directly hires, contracts and manages Project Managers and Scrum Masters, while understanding and championing team objectives and key results.

  • Builds high-performing teams through mentorship, communication of job expectations, planning and monitoring, driving growth and skill development.

  • Engagement with IT peers and management on expectations and prioritization.

  • Works with the IT Center of Delivery Excellence (COE) to follow standards, influence best practices and ensure team members are fully trained.

  • Ensures best delivery practices, processes and procedures that drive speedy and quality outcomes.

  • Collaborates with internal and external teams to ensure we are delivering value and providing high levels of internal customer service.

  • Owns and shares financial, key metrics and roadmaps for respective areas in IT to drive central view.

  • Project Managers lead smaller to complex, multi-functional projects, often global, and handle more than one significant project at a time. Scrum Masters manage 1-3 product teams depending upon scope and complexity. Activation of Agile and Waterfall Processes to enable timely delivery of capabilities.

  • Organization of the work, timing and resource planning across teams, coordination of cross-team dependencies, and other teams such as core, platform, etc. (i.e., Scrum of Scrums)

  • Drives demand planning activities within the assigned IT organization using our IT planning tools (Service Now, Jira, ACTs, Planview).

  • Prepares project status material and capable of presenting to executive management.

  • Supports RFP/RFQ activities, including vendor meetings, scorecard creation, security reviews, and other mandated activities.

  • Coordinates and communicates reporting of respective pillar to drive to overall Digital Experience KPI’s and metrics.

Skills/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ree preferred

  • 12+ Years’ relevant experience in managing Project Managers and/or Scrum Masters

  • Project Management certification a plus

  • Ability to work with cross-functional teams and stakeholders

  • Excellent communication skills

  • Leadership skills

  • Travel up to 15% as needed

Applicants must be authorized to work in the US without requiring sponsorship now or in the future.

The salary range for this position is $129,150 - $165,000. The specific salary offered to a candidate may be influenced by a variety of factors including the candidate’s experience, their education, and the work location. Available benefits include medical, dental, vision & 401k.
